Subject: Key rotation — stringpull extraction script

Team: the credential used by stringpull (our translation-string extraction script) rotates tonight. Old key dies at 18:00. CI jobs on Loomdeck pick up the new value automatically; local runs need a manual update. Nothing else changes — same endpoint, same scopes. For local use, the replacement key is below.

service key, fawip-bajef: kto11_Qt5wZK9vdNC

## Onboarding: Fareweight Rules Engine

Fareweight computes shipping fees from stacked rule sets. Rules are versioned; never edit a live version. Deploys go through the staging evaluator first. Read the rule DSL guide before touching anything.

Rule definitions live in the pricing database — connect to it with the connection string below.

primary connection of yagep-bajop = postgresql://druiel_svc:gW@db-3860.sivrelworks.example:5432/brieth

### Runbook: ReceiptRelay mailer stuck

Symptoms: donation receipts queueing, no sends, queue depth alert fires.

First: check the SMTP relay health endpoint. If healthy, the mailer worker is probably wedged on a malformed template — restart the worker pool, not the whole service. If unhealthy, fail over to the secondary relay and page the infra rotation. Do not replay the dead-letter queue until dedupe is confirmed on, or donors get duplicate receipts. Verify the service is running with the following configuration values.

config for kajeg-bafop:
[julael]
host = julael.plorvadata.corp
user = julael_svc
database = julael_prod

Handover — reminder job, for security review

Torsten: the Meadowbrook clinic reminder job now runs nightly at 02:00. Patient list pulls are read-only; SMS payloads contain no diagnoses. Retries capped at three. Audit log ships to the compliance bucket. The job's secrets vault is sealed; to unseal for review, use the recovery passphrase below.

vault phrase of hawif-bahof = novvan-belius-istael-fenvan-holdor-druox-eliath